The mission of the Gold Coast Triathletes Club is to provide a way for liked minded athletes in South Florida Community to meet and train together.  The club  provides a venue for communication, allows athletes to make valuable connections, friendships and  met training partners. Club members are encouraged to support one another at races and in training.  The club also  promotes educational opportunities through socials and advice from members.  It allows athletes of all levels to learn more about training and racing in the sport.

Members are very good hearted, down to earth athletes that  enjoy supporting each other in many ways.  We have athletes of all levels including Beginners to Elite athletes! The club provides an invaluable triathlon experience for members that participate.

Special Thanks to Personal Trainer Linda Lardino-Semko for presenting and demonstrating various Functional Strength Training exercises during our JUNE SOCIAL!    She went over many exercises we can perform to help make us stronger and fitter for racing.   We had a nice turnout of about 13 athletes for the demonstration, with about 9 of us doing the exercises.  

Linda discussed what we could do in a quick 30 minutes that would target using our entire body and strengthen our core.  Many of the exercises included things we could do at home  such as using dumb bells, tubing, fit balls, own body weight and bosu ball or unstable surfaces.  She also handed out coupons for a free spin class and discounts on Body Fat testing to all participants.   She plans on getting us handouts of the exercises as well as some articles to help us incorporate what we learned into our own  training.  After the presentation and workout....Many of us headed out to dinner immediately afterwards and had a great time socializing!   Next social will be sometime in August!
